Speech and Language Pathologist – Vanderhoof and Area

Northwest Child Development Centre (formerly Bulkley Valley Child Development Centre)

A temporary full time (35 hours/week) position to start As soon as possible - Parental Leave Coverage.

Job Summary:
Our Speech and Language Pathologist functions as a member of an interdisciplinary team providing speech
language pathology services to the pediatric caseload of children with special needs or at risk for delays in
development. The Therapist’s role with children and families is one of facilitation and prevention using his/her specialized skills and knowledge to assist the child in developing to their maximum potential. The position works as a member of a family-centered, interdisciplinary team providing therapy and support services for children and their families. The duties of this position follow the guidelines of the College of Speech and Hearing Health Professionals of BC [CSHHPBC]. This position is located at our Vanderhoof community-based office and provides outreach to the surrounding communities of Fort St. James and Fraser Lake.
Our Team:
Our new Speech and Language Pathologist will join our current two Speech and Language Pathologists, within our organization's Pediatric Therapy Network, for peer support and individual/team mentorship. Also within our Pediatric Therapy Network, you will have access to professional development opportunities, resource development through sharing of specialized equipment libraries and work with specialized therapeutic teams to serve across many communities of our service delivery area (communities of the Nechako Lakes, Bulkley Valley,Upper Skeena). As part of the Vanderhoof based team, you will work in liaison with a Therapy Assistant and Speech-Language Pathology Assistant to aide with therapy delivery and resource development.
